Skip to content

Commit

Permalink
Test-5
Browse files Browse the repository at this point in the history
  • Loading branch information
shmuz committed Dec 5, 2024
1 parent d6e9f99 commit db10ee6
Show file tree
Hide file tree
Showing 3 changed files with 6 additions and 2 deletions.
5 changes: 4 additions & 1 deletion far/src/macro/macro.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-163,8 +163,11 @@ static const wchar_t* GetMacroLanguage(DWORD Flags)
static bool CallMacroPlugin(OpenMacroPluginInfo* Info)
{
#ifdef USELUA
return CtrlObject->Plugins.CallPlugin(SYSID_LUAMACRO, OPEN_LUAMACRO, Info) != 0;
int ret = CtrlObject->Plugins.CallPlugin(SYSID_LUAMACRO, OPEN_LUAMACRO, Info);
exit(ret ? 8 : 9);
return ret != 0;
#else
exit(10);
return false;
#endif
}
Expand Down
1 change: 0 additions & 1 deletion far/src/main.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-739,7 +739,6 @@ static void SetCustomSettings(const char *arg)

int _cdecl main(int argc, char *argv[])
{
return 5;
char *name = strrchr(argv[0], GOOD_SLASH);
if (name) ++name; else name = argv[0];
if (argc > 0) {
Expand Down
2 changes: 2 additions & 0 deletions far/src/plug/PluginW.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-454,6 +454,7 @@ static BOOL LoadLuafar()
}
if (!handle)
{
exit(6);
Message(MSG_WARNING, 1, Msg::Error, L"Neither LuaJIT nor Lua5.1 library was found", Msg::Ok);
return FALSE;
}
Expand All @@ -464,6 +465,7 @@ static BOOL LoadLuafar()
BOOL LuafarLoaded = dlopen(strLuaFar.GetMB().c_str(), RTLD_LAZY|RTLD_GLOBAL) ? TRUE : FALSE;
if (!LuafarLoaded)
{
exit(7);
Message(MSG_WARNING, 1, Msg::Error, L"Cannot load luafar.so", Msg::Ok);
}
return LuafarLoaded;
Expand Down

0 comments on commit db10ee6

Please sign in to comment.